Kimber - In our situation, the original executor of the estate was also terminally ill and passed away a few months after we filed the first non-GRE T3 return. When her executor contacted us for assistance with both estates, she provided a Notice of Assessment showing the s.15 penalty, along with a collections notice. After investigating, we discovered that the mailed T3 return (which wasn't eligible for EFILE) was missing Schedule 15. The schedule had been prepared, but our tax software's print settings didn't include it in the government copy for paper-filed returns - so it never made it into the package that went to CRA. In our taxpayer relief request submitted in September 2024, we explained the accidental omission and the original executor's illness and subsequent passing, which delayed our office being made aware of the CRA correspondence. CRA accepted the circumstances and granted relief in July 2025. Hope that helps!

I've had CRA assess a penalty for failing to include Schedule 15 with the first T3 return filed after the 36-month GRE period ended. In our case, we requested taxpayer relief and CRA cancelled the penalty (although when they cancelled the penalty, they did not apply the cancellation to the account balance properly so the SIN is still showing an amount payable and subsequently the clearance certificate is being held up).
